
As the French international targets a switch to La Liga, the Bavarian giants are pulling out all the stops to persuade their prized asset to remain in Germany.
The future of Michael Olise is once again a major talking point in the transfer market. According to reports from L’Equipe, the Bayern Munchen forward has identified Real Madrid as his absolute priority, viewing the La Liga as the natural next step for his career development.
The French publication suggests the newly-capped international took advantage of his recent time with the France national team to sound out his teammates regarding life at the “Maison Blanche.” Olise reportedly consulted players such as Kylian Mbappe, keen to gain a deeper understanding of the standards and daily expectations at the Santiago Bernabeu.
Faced with the player’s desire to depart, Bayern Munchen are working tirelessly behind the scenes to retain one of their brightest prospects. Defender Dayot Upamecano is reportedly acting as a mediator in the situation, attempting to convince his compatriot to commit his long-term future to Bavaria by highlighting the winning culture and relentless ambition of the German giants.
While no formal agreement has yet been reached between Real Madrid and Michael Olise, the situation is already developing into one of the most high-profile sagas of the window. The Munich hierarchy, meanwhile, remains steadfast in its determination to keep hold of one of the most promising talents in the squad.
